: All methods and procedures for this study were carried out according to relevant guidelines and regulations. The study was approved by the Research Ethics Committee (REC), Faculty of Nursing/ Port Said University/ Egypt, with trial registration number (NUR 13/3/2022–11) based on the standard of the committee, Faculty of Nursing/ Port Said University and adhered to declaration of Helinski. The study also retrospectively registered under the following number: PACTR202507513786427 on 1 July 2025. An official letter containing the title and the aim of the study was sent from the Dean of the Faculty of Nursing - Port Said University to the director of Port Said Psychiatric Health Hospital and Addiction Treatment to obtain approval from the hospital administrator for data collection in the abovementioned settings. Approval was taken from the General Secretariat of Mental Health and Addiction Treatment to conduct the study. Additionally, informed consent was taken from each participant (caregivers) after clearing out all aspects of the study to be familiar with the importance of their participation. The study did not directly or indirectly expose psychiatric patients’ caregivers to any diagnosis or treatment.
